7.
If a 7.5 k
resistance is connected to a 10 k
inductive reactance in a series RL circuit, then the impedance equals 12.5 k
.

Given , r=7.5k
xL=wL=10k
z=r+jxL => mod z =sq root of(r^2+xL^2)
impedance Z=sqrt[(7.5)^2+(10)^2]
=12.5
